对于接触以太坊较早的资深用户或特定项目参与者来说,“以太坊0.1钱包”或许承载着特殊的意义,不少用户在尝试打开或查看这个早期版本的以太坊钱包时,却遇到了“看不到”的困惑,这个“看不到”可能表现为多种形式:无法在应用列表中找到、点击无反应、或者界面显示异常,本文将深入探讨这一现象的可能原因,并提供相应的排查与解决方法,助您找回这个“消失”的0.1钱包。
“以太坊0.1钱包看不到”的可能原因
-
版本兼容性问题:
- 操作系统过旧/过新: 以太坊0.1版本钱包是非常早期的产物,其设计之初并未考虑到后续操作系统的快速迭代,当用户使用过新的操作系统(如最新版的Windows 11, macOS Sonoma及以上)时,由于缺少必要的运行库或驱动支持,钱包可能无法正常启动或显示,同样,如果操作系统过于老旧,也可能缺少必要的组件。
- 依赖库缺失: 0.1版本钱包可能依赖于特定的运行时环境(如.NET Framework早期版本、特定的Visual C++ Redistributable等),这些在当前系统中可能未被默认安装或版本不匹配。
-
钱包文件损坏或路径错误:
- 核心文件丢失: 钱包的可执行文件(如
ethereum.exe)或其依赖的动态链接库(.dll文件)如果损坏、丢失,自然无法运行。 - 数据目录问题: 以太坊0.1钱包会将数据(如区块数据、钱包文件)存储在特定的用户目录下,如果这个目录被误删、权限错误,或者被安全软件拦截,可能导致钱包无法正常初始化或显示界面。
- 核心文件丢失: 钱包的可执行文件(如
-
安全软件拦截:
- 误杀与拦截: 0.1版本钱包的数字签名可能早已过期,或者其行为模式(如访问网络、读写本地文件)被现代安全软件(杀毒软件、防火墙)判定为可疑,从而被阻止运行或隐藏。
-
显示问题或分辨率适配:
- 界面显示异常: 在高分辨率显示器或不同缩放比例的屏幕上,非常老旧的软件界面可能出现显示错乱、部分区域不可见,甚至直接黑屏无反应的情况。
- 多显示器设置: 如果钱包界面被意外拖拽到了当前未连接或处于扩展模式之外的第二显示器上,用户也会感觉“看不到”。
-
钱包本身已停止维护或存在Bug:
- 历史遗留问题: 以太坊0.1版本是极其古老的开发版本,可能存在未修复的Bug,导致在特定条件下无法正常启动或显示界面,官方早已不再对其进行维护。
-
用户误操作或混淆:
- 未正确安装或下载: 用户可能只是下载了钱包的压缩包但未解压,或解压后未运行正确的可执行文件。
- 与其他钱包混淆: 同时安装了多个以太坊相关钱包,可能记不清具体哪个是0.1版本。
排查与解决方法
面对“以太坊0.1钱包看不到”的问题,可以按照以下步骤进行排查:
-
确认钱包文件位置与完整性:
- 首先找到您下载或存放以太坊0.1钱包文件的文件夹。
- 确认核心可执行文件(如
ethereum.exe或类似名称的文件)是否存在。 - 尝试重新下载一个可信来源的以太坊0.1版本钱包,替换现有文件,确保文件未损坏。
-
检查操作系统兼容性:
- 尝试兼容模式: 右键点击钱包的可执行文件,选择“属性”,在“兼容性”选项卡中,勾选“以兼容模式运行这个程序”,并尝试选择较旧的Windows系统版本(如Windows 7或Windows XP模式)。
- 安装必要运行库: 根据钱包发布时的系统要求,手动下载并安装对应的.NET Framework版本、Visual C++ Redistributable等,0.1版本可能需要.NET Framework 3.5或4.0。
-
检查安全软件设置:
- 暂时禁用安全软件: 在确保环境安全的前提下,暂时禁用杀毒软件和防火墙,然后尝试运行钱包,如果可以运行,则说明是安全软件拦截,将其添加到安全软件的白名单中。
- 检查防火墙规则: 确保防火墙允许该钱包程序的网络访问(如果钱包需要同步区块链)。
-
